DoD Identifies Army Casualties

The Department of Defense announced today the deaths of two soldiers who were supporting Operation Iraqi Freedom. 

 

The soldiers were killed on Dec. 22 in Baghdad, Iraq, when an improvised explosive device struck their convoy.  Killed were: 

 

1st Lt. Edward M. Saltz, 27, U.S. Army Reserve, of Bigfork, Mont., and

 

Pfc. Stuart W. Moore, 21, of Livingston, Texas. 

 

Both Soldiers were assigned to 2nd Battalion, 3rd Field Artillery Regiment, 1st Armored Division, based in Giessen, Germany.

 

The incident is under investigation.
